15.3: Properties of Parallelograms

Page 6: Activity 15. Quadrilateral A polygon with 4 sides

Parallelogram

• A quadrilateral with both pairs of opposite sides parallel

Properties:

1. Opposite sides are congruent (thm)

2. Opposite angles are congruent (thm)

3. Consecutive angles are supplementary

4. Diagonals bisect each other (thm)

5. If there is one right angle, then there are 4 right angles

15.4 Special Parallelograms

Page 12: Activity 15. Quadrilateral A polygon with 4 sides

Rhombi• A parallelogram with all four sides congruent

Rhombus Properties:

• Diagonals of a rhombus are perpendicular

• Each diagonal bisects a pair of opposite angles.

Parallelogram Properties:

• Opposite sides congruent and parallel

• Opposite angles congruent

• Diagonals bisect each other

Rectangles

• A parallelogram with four right angles

Rectangle Properties:

• Diagonals of a rectangle are congruent Parallelogram Properties:

• Opposite sides congruent and parallel

• Opposite angles congruent

• Diagonals bisect each other

Square

• A parallelogram with 4 congruent sides and 4 right angles

• Has all properties of parallelograms, rectangles, and rhombi– Opposite sides congruent and parallel– Diagonals are congruent, perpendicular, bisect

each other and bisect pairs of opposite angles

Page 17: Activity 15. Quadrilateral A polygon with 4 sides

Trapezoids

Page 18: Activity 15. Quadrilateral A polygon with 4 sides

Trapezoid

• A quadrilateral with exactly one pair of parallel sides

• NOT a parallelogram… does not have properties of one

• Parallel sides are called bases

• Nonparallel sides are called legs

Isosceles Trapezoid

• A trapezoid with legs congruent to each other

Properties of An Isosceles Trapezoid:

• Both pairs of base angles are congruent

• Non-congruent angles are supplementary

• Diagonals of an isosceles trapezoid are congruent

Median of a Trapezoid

• Segment that joins the midpoints of the legs of a trapezoid

• Parallel to the bases

• Median equals ½ the sum of the bases

UV = (½)(WX + ZY)

Kite• A quadrilateral with exactly two distinct pairs of adjacent congruent sides

Important Facts:

• Diagonals of a kite are perpendicular• One pair of opposite angles are congruent• Other two angles bisected by diagonals• Look for pairs of congruent triangles!
